Focusing on the public records of a Texas county, the book reveals the active roles of women in the nineteenth century, challenging the notion of their invisibility. Angela Boswell examines how Southern women's lives intertwined with societal structures during the frontier, antebellum, Civil War, and Reconstruction eras. By analyzing diverse records, she highlights the experiences of women across class and race, showcasing a complex patriarchy influenced by men in both public and domestic spheres. This work offers an inclusive perspective on historical women's contributions.
